Hello,

That is possible to simulate OXE with Virtualbox or Vmware. Get a OXE release from ALU BPWS, if you have an account.
After having set your Virtualbox with an OS (other linux). You can install the OXE version with the Omnipcx installer.
You will need to have OPS licences. You can load in your virtual machine any OPS licenses accordingly with the right OXE version.
It will be valid for 30 days only. After you will have to reinstall and to reload the OPS licenses file. Except if someone can
tell you how to bypass this probelm.
You will be able to use IP phone and sip phone. Digital and analog is not possible, they need to be connected behind specific boards.
If you have some hardware GD(and also to play with voice guides and conference), SLI or UA boards, you will be able to do it. You can also simulate OXE pbx network.
Configuration that you will be able to do, will depend of the opened licenses from your OPS.

I installed the OXE software in VMware and it was working fine in my case. You may use the Magic disk software for mounting the OXE .iso file and select the hardware type as blade server in PC installer.
